RFP N62742-26-R-1306 Notice No. 2 Page 1 of 2 Notice No. 2 April 29, 2026 PRE-PROPOSAL QUESTIONS & ANSWERS RFP N62742-26-R-1306 JFY 2022 PROJECT J-875, BATTLE STAFF TRAINING FACILITY, U.S. NAVSUPPACT MCB CAMP BLAZ, GUAM NOTE: The following questions and answers are provided for INFORMATION ONLY. The RFP remains unchanged unless it is amended in writing on a Standard Form 30. REVISED RESPONSE FROM NOTICE 1: 1. Reference: Spec Section 01 57 19.03 20 MEC / UXO Requirements. Spec section 01 57 19.03 20 is included in the RFP, which to our understanding is outdated. Please advise if Spec Section 01 57 19.03 21 “Supplemental Temporary Environmental Controls – Secretary of the Navy (SECNAV) Explosive Safety Risk Acceptance Within Joint Region Marianas” would apply to this project, and if so, provide revised spec section for the J-875 project. (See attached from P-678 as reference). RFI No. 01_01 57 19.03 21 P-678 Supp ANSWER: Section 01 57 19.03 20 will be replaced with Section 01 57 19.03 21 in a forthcoming amendment. 2. Reference: Spec Section 03 42 13.00 10 Plant Precast Concrete Products - Reinforcment. Spec section 03 42 13.00 10 includes reference ASTM listings for epoxy coated reinforcing bars and steel wire and welded wire reinforcement. As the project site is well above the water table, and local precast manufacturers do not provide epoxy coated reinforcement in their products, we interpret that the epoxy coated reinforcement in not intended for this project. Please confirm that if epoxy coated reinforcement is not specifically called out for in the product detail in the drawings, it is not required. DEPARTMENT OF THE NAVY COMMANDER NAVAL FACILITIES ENGINEERING SYSTEMS COMMAND PACIFIC 258 MAKALAPA DRIVE SUITE 100 PEARL HARBOR HI 96860-3134 -- 1 of 2 -- RFP N62742-26-R-1306 Notice No. 2 Page 2 of 2 ANSWER: Section 03 42 13.00 10 will be revised to delete the requirement for epoxy-coated reinforcing, in a forthcoming amendment. 5. Reference: Factor 1: Experience RELEVANT CONSTRUCTION PROJECT: For purposes of this evaluation, a relevant construction project is defined as new construction of a multi-story administrative, office, training, or communications facility consisting of cast-in-place reinforced concrete building structure of approximately $30 million or more in dollar value and completed or substantially completed no earlier than ten (10) years from the date of issuance of this solicitation. Building repair, renovation, conversion, and addition work will not be considered as a relevant project. Question: The contractor requests clarification on whether the Government will consider construction projects in the $20 million range as meeting the definition of a relevant construction project in lieu of the stated $30 million threshold. ANSWER: The Government will evaluate relevant experience in accordance with the established criteria defined in the solicitation. Offerors are required to submit projects that they believe best demonstrate their experience that are similar in size, scope, and complexity to the type of project defined in the solicitation. NOTICE NO. 2: 7. Reference: Section 00 21 16 - Instructions to Proposers (incl. AMD001), paragraph 1.2 Will the Government please consider revising the instructions to allow for the use of PIEE for the initial proposal volumes followed by physical hard copies with wet signatures within 5 business days via courier or hand delivery? ANSWER: The solicitation remains unchanged. End of Notice -- 2 of 2 --
